28 April - At 10 am our riverboat docked in Willemstad, a tiny Dutch town enclosed within a seven-pointed star fortress. The descrition of this type fortification reminded me of Fort McHenry in Baltimore. The town was named for William the Silent of the 1500s. Silent William's great grandson became one half of the team of William and Mary of England.
We took off for our town tour and organ recital at the oldest Protestant church in Holland. The temperatures were 42 to 60 degrees F.
